Life Giver

Crucial to life
Yet so humble
Has no form
Willing to transform
Takes on The shape
Imposed upon it
Bottle, bowl
Bucket, barrel
Can, carton
Jar, jug
Pitcher, pot
Tumbler, tube
Tub, tank …
Rich in virtues
Refreshes, renews
Makes music
Pleasing acoustic
Songs of joy
For all to enjoy
Purifies all it touches
As it runs along
Squeezed through 
Slit-like crevices
Pushed brutally
Over rocks
Violently thrashed
While landing on stone
No complaints
About restraints
Polluted by nature
Mostly by humans
Purifies itself
Seeking natural filters
Along the way
Remains beautiful
Life giving 
Till the very end –
(Whenever that is)
Let me be at least a fraction
Of what water
IS
